How much does it cost to rent a home in Opa Locka Airport?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Opa Locka Airport 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,338 | $1,900 | $2,830 |
| Opa Locka Airport 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,349 | $2,300 | $4,345 |
| Opa Locka Airport 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,987 | $3,500 | $4,800 |
| Opa Locka Airport 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,841 | $3,375 | $4,270 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Opa Locka Airport
What type of rentals are currently available in Opa Locka Airport?
There are currently 162 Apartments for Rent in Opa Locka Airport, FL with pricing that ranges from $950 to $7,389. There are also 83 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Opa Locka Airport ranging from $1,200 to $4,800.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Opa Locka Airport?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Opa Locka Airport ranges from $1,200 to $4,800 with an average monthly rent of $2,761.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Opa Locka Airport?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Opa Locka Airport range from $1,994 to $3,937,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,300 to $4,345.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,009.
